AJMI Organizes The Comprehensive Journalist Course for QNA

AJMI - Doha

In an effort to enhance cooperation between Al Jazeera Media Institute (AJMI) and the Qatar News Agency (QNA), "The Comprehensive Journalist" course will be held from 10th to 18th October.

The participants of this course include 11 journalists from QNA and will be trained by the Expert trainer, Mohammed Dawood, the Director of Standards and Quality Control at the Al Jazeera Media Network. 
The course will address two main topics: journalistic editing and mobile journalism.

In journalistic editing, participants will be introduced to the essence of journalistic editing, its rules and its significance in media institutions. As well as the news editing techniques, the importance of news headlines, rules aiding their formulation and the writing of news reports, their types and advantages.

On the other hand, the second topic will be dedicated to mobile journalism where Dr. Hussam Wahba, a media expert in editorial standards at the network, sheds light on narrative techniques and stories suitable for mobile platforms, visual composition, sizes and angles of shots, montage techniques and other related topics.

Upon concluding the course, the trainees will be assigned to prepare graduation projects, which will consist of a comprehensive media project on mobile phones, aiming to gauge the benefits derived from the course.

It is worth noting that the Institute has previously collaborated with QNA, having organised up to 15 training courses for its members in 2021
